Howdy Patriot Font for Web Design
Working on a new boutique online store project, I was looking for a font that could add a touch of personality without overshadowing the content. Howdy Patriot caught my eye with its bold, dancing western style and Americana color palette. It felt like the perfect fit for a brand that wants to stand out while maintaining a clean digital presence.
The font has a unique character—each letter seems to have a little twirl or flourish, giving it a lively, handcrafted feel. The full-color design means every letter is already colored, so there's no need to apply separate styles or gradients. It's especially useful for headers and logos where visual impact matters most.

Readability and User Experience
One of the key considerations when using a decorative font like Howdy Patriot is readability. While it's excellent for headlines and short phrases, it's not ideal for long blocks of text. I made sure to use it only in areas where it would be most effective, such as headings, banners, and promotional tags.
For image overlays, the font held up well, especially when placed over solid color backgrounds. However, I found that on complex images with lots of detail, the font sometimes got lost. In those cases, I switched to a simpler typeface to ensure the message was clear and easy to read.
Font Pairing and Design Integration
Pairing Howdy Patriot with a clean, modern sans serif font created a balanced look that felt professional yet creative. This combination worked well for product landing pages, where the display font grabbed attention and the body font provided clarity.
For a coaching website, I used Howdy Patriot in the header and subheadings, while a serif font handled the blog content. This pairing gave the site a polished, editorial feel that resonated with the target audience.
